CAUTION: When installing and removing an Optional Interface Module, note that:

Do not exert excessive force on the module or touch the components on the module surface.

If you are not installing a new module, insert a blank filler panel to keep the dust out and to ensure normal ventilation within the switch.

Packing and This section describes how to correctly package your Switch 5500 should Shipping the Switch you need to return the switch to 3Com.

5500

WARNING: If you are returning the unit to 3Com for repair, ensure that you fit the rear blanking plates for the PSU and module. If 3Com receives the unit without the blanking plates in place your warranty could be invalidated.

WARNING: Package the unit correctly to ensure that you do not invalidate the repair.

The Switch 5500G To package your Switch 5500G unit correctly:

1For the 5500G unit, orientate your switch so that the PSU blanking plate is on the left (looking down at the top of the unit) as shown in Figure 19.

2Secure one of the polystyrene supports to side of the unit with the PSU blanking plate, ensuring that the wider recess on the support is fitted around the blanking plate. Secure the remaining support to the opposite side of the unit in the same way.

3Place the unit in the box with the PSU blanking plate side placed next to the cable packaging.

The 3Com 5500-EI and 5500G-EI series are advanced Ethernet switches designed for enterprise networks, catering to the growing demand for high-performance, secure, and scalable networking solutions. These switches are particularly suited for large organizations that require robust management capabilities and high-density connectivity.

One of the key features of the 5500-EI and 5500G-EI models is their modular architecture, which allows businesses to tailor the switch configuration to their specific needs. With options for various interface modules, including Gigabit Ethernet and PoE (Power over Ethernet), these switches can support diverse networking requirements and facilitate the gradual expansion of the network infrastructure.

The Series offers advanced Layer 2 and Layer 3 switching capabilities. Layer 2 features include VLAN tagging, trunking, and Spanning Tree Protocol (STP) to ensure efficient traffic management and network segmentation. On the Layer 3 front, the switches support static routing, RIP, and OSPF, enabling dynamic routing protocols for better traffic flow and load balancing. These features together enhance the performance and reliability of enterprise applications.

Security is another vital aspect of the 3Com 5500-EI and 5500G-EI series. The switches come equipped with robust security features to protect sensitive data and maintain compliance. These include MAC address filtering, access control lists (ACLs), and support for 802.1X authentication. Additionally, the devices support secure management protocols like SNMP v3, which enhances the security of management communications.

The 5500G-EI model stands out with its high-density port offerings, supporting up to 48 ports in a single switch, with an option for stacking to create a unified management platform across multiple switches. This flexibility allows organizations to leverage their existing infrastructure while scaling seamlessly in response to growing demands.

Another notable characteristic is the built-in IPv6 support, which positions the 3Com 5500-EI and 5500G-EI models favorably for future-proofing enterprise networks as the transition to IPv6 continues. This feature ensures that organizations can maintain connectivity as devices increasingly adopt the newer protocol.
